Description
Delicious and fluffy muffins made with ripe bananas and swirled with Nutella, perfect for breakfast or as a sweet treat.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 ripe bananas, mashed
- 1/2 cup Nutella
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/3 cup vegetable oil
- 1 large egg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p baking soda
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
- Combine the mashed bananas, sugar, vegetable oil, egg, and vanilla extract in a large bowl. Mix until everything melds together beautifully.
- Wh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in another bowl, ensuring no lumps remain.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the banana mixture, stirring just until combined. It’s okay if a few streaks of flour remain.
- Fold in the Nutella gently, creating swirls.
- Divide the batter among the muffin cups, filling each around two-thirds full.
-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Allow the muffins to cool in the tin for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
Notes
Muffins can be prepared in advance and refrigerated overnight. Best enjoyed warm.
